Transaction 54899dbb17c1653eaa12222ed7e6c3f5e876a5a3427cca2f7ff5370c830c082b
1 Input
1 Output
-
54899dbb17c1653eaa12222ed7e6c3f5e876a5a3427cca2f7ff5370c830c082b:0
- value
- 169968426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 622829ea0927a43a31f4c9989601f11427292291 OP_EQUAL
- address
- 3Ae2Fy63kBrBvXYo5V7DjdLkR2ZiQm7Dvi